Somnio Lupus is a literate post-by-post role-playing game that takes place on a planet very much like earth. If you could see it, it would be the image of a young earth before things were civilized and destroyed by the human race. Only animals inhabit this planet, but the wolves are the most successful predatory animal. Free to roam anywhere, except on another pack's land; these wolves are both alike and different than wolves on Earth. Many of the sub-species that exist on earth have also grown to exist here, but six unique sub-species have also formed and adapted to the life they live now. Roam where you wish, but be prepared to face the consequences of your actions.

* S E A S O N │ W I N T E R ;
Winter is a cruel mistress in this world. Nights are longer and the ground freezes at night. The waters all over the continent have become freezing, though one can still travel through them. Each biome is affected differently. The Northern Rainforests see only a cold rain; The swamplands get continuous, cold rain with mixed hail; the Central Savannah is randomly covered in as much as four inches of snow; the Central Forests are rarely not covered in snow and its as deep as 10 inches; the Western Drylands are seeing mixed rain, snow and sleet at least once a week; the beaches to the East are cold and snowy, and ice can be seen forming around the shore; and the Southern Icelands are experiencing a horrendous blizzard that has no signs of letting up anytime soon.
